    Menstruation is a normal periodicflow of blood from the uterus.

    It is sometimes called the period. The periodic cycle is a succession

    of changes going on in the femalebody that involves menstruation.

    Each cycle starts at the beginning

    of a menstrual period. Ordinarily each cycle takes about

    28 days.

    Amenorrhea - absence of flow Oligomenorrhea- cyclic bleeding at

    abnormally long intervals

    Hypomenorrhea- reduced amount andduration of the monthly flow

    Menorrhagia- profuse or prolonged bleedingwhich appears cyclically at intervals ofapproximately 28 days

  • 7/27/2019 Menstrual Cyle and Pregnancy

    4/25

    Polymenorrhea-normal orrefuse bleeding at regular

    intervals of 21 days or less

    Dysmennorhea- cases whereabdominal pain is experiencesjust before or during flow; It isalso is the so-called painfulmenstruation.

    Toxemia of Pregnancy is one of the most importantcomplications of pregnancy.

    It may cause stillbirth or premature birth, or renderthe baby feeble and poorly developed after birth.

    It is most prevalent during the late months of

    pregnancy and apparently caused by poison whichaccumulates in the blood.

  • 7/27/2019 Menstrual Cyle and Pregnancy

    17/25

    Toxemia cause: high blood pressure

    Headache blurred vision

    Vomiting

    presence of albumin in the urine

    swelling due to water in the tissue andother symptoms.
